About V. Petrov
V. Petrov is a scholar working on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Condensed Matter Physics,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Control and Systems Engineering, having authored 71 papers that have together received 2.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Quantum Chromodynamics and Particle Interactions (38 papers), Particle physics theoretical and experimental studies (32 papers), High-Energy Particle Collisions Research (22 papers), Black Holes and Theoretical Physics (12 papers), Cold Atom Physics and Bose-Einstein Condensates (11 papers),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(7 papers), Quantum, superfluid, helium dynamics (6 papers) and Quantum and electron transport phenomena (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nuclear and High Energy Physics (2.6k citations), Condensed Matter Physics (157 citations), Astronomy and Astrophysics (150 cit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(280 citations) and Statistical and Nonlinear Physics (81 citations). V. Petrov has collaborated with scholars based in Russia, Germany and Denmark. Frequent co-authors include D.I. D'yakonov, Dmitri Diakonov, P. V. Pobylitsa, Maxim V. Polyakov, C. Weiss, K. Goeke, Michael I. Eides, A. Blotz, Michał Praszałowicz and Nikolay Gromov. Their work appears in journals such as Physics Letters B, Nuclear Physics B, Journal of Experimental and Theoretical Physics Letters, Physical review. D and Physical Review A.
